Be Light: Year of Belonging by Witness to Love is the first year of a five year movement to draw Catholic married couples closer together in Christ while being transformed into family missionary disciples.  The Year of Belonging highlights twelve Witness Couples from around the country exploring various topics that unpack the Sacrament of Matrimony. Belonging (the first of five years for the Be Light Series) will be released on the first Thursday of each month. The couple testimony video will be supplemented with an additional video of a priest or deacon covering the same topic released on the 2nd Thursday of the month, a podcast on the 3rd and will wrap up with a music event on the 4th Thursday of each month.

Registration is FREE and each series will be released via the Witness to Love App and via registered participants email.

Jake and Ramie Samour

Ramie and Jake Samour have been married for 15 years and they reside in Wichita, Kansas, known as “the Heartland” of America. They have six children; one boy and five girls. Jake is the Director of the Office of Marriage and Family Life for the Diocese of Wichita and the representative for the Hispanic Section of the National Association of Catholic Family Life Ministers (NACFLM). Jake was born in El Salvador and immigrated to the United States with his parents and 11 siblings more than 40 years ago. Ramie is the oldest of nine siblings and is a Kansas native. She and Jake met while pursuing graduate theology degrees at the John Paul II Institute. Although they both remain involved in marriage and family ministry, Ramie’s focus is on educating their children at home. Both have a passion for serving couples and families in their journey to true joy. Their family enjoys the great outdoors, time with cousins, aunts and uncles, grandparents… and of course, great friends.

Ben and Maria Domingue

Ben and Maria Domingue celebrated their 5th wedding anniversary in October! They met in Louisiana when Maria was transitioning back to college after having served as a missionary with Family Missions Company for 6 years and when Ben was transitioning from LSU football to serve as a missionary with FOCUS (The Fellowship of Catholic University Students). Maria is a nurse midwife with Bella Health and Wellness, a Catholic, comprehensive healthcare practice in the Denver Metro area. Ben serves as a Director of Philanthropy for FOCUS. Both are proud of their native homes – Ben is proud of his Cajun Catholic heritage and Maria was born and raised in a small town in Ireland only a few minutes drive from the Marian apparition site in Knock,Ireland. They are raising two crazy Cajun-Irish toddlers in Denver, Colorado. Ben and Maria are grateful to be still in love and in mission together.
